Cpap Therapy: Enhancing Sleep Quality And Restful Nights Explained

does the c-pap help you sleep better

Sleep apnea is a common sleep disorder characterized by repeated interruptions in breathing during sleep, often leading to fragmented rest and daytime fatigue. Continuous Positive Airway Pressure (CPAP) therapy is a widely prescribed treatment for this condition, involving a machine that delivers a steady stream of air through a mask to keep the airway open. Many users report significant improvements in sleep quality, as CPAP helps reduce snoring, apnea episodes, and nighttime awakenings. However, its effectiveness can vary depending on factors like mask fit, adherence to usage, and individual sleep patterns. While CPAP is not a cure, it is often considered a cornerstone of managing sleep apnea, offering many users a chance to achieve deeper, more restorative sleep.

CPAP effectiveness in improving sleep quality

Sleep apnea disrupts sleep through repeated breathing pauses, causing fragmented rest and daytime fatigue. CPAP (Continuous Positive Airway Pressure) therapy directly addresses this by delivering a steady stream of pressurized air, keeping the airway open. This mechanical intervention prevents apneas and hypopneas, the hallmark disruptions of sleep apnea. Studies consistently show that CPAP use significantly reduces the Apnea-Hypopnea Index (AHI), a measure of sleep apnea severity, often lowering it from severe (AHI >30) to mild or normal levels (AHI <5). This reduction in breathing events translates to fewer awakenings, longer periods of uninterrupted sleep, and improved overall sleep architecture, as documented in polysomnography (sleep study) data.

While CPAP's effectiveness is well-established, adherence remains a critical factor. Optimal benefits require consistent nightly use for at least 4 hours, ideally throughout the entire sleep period. Patients who use CPAP for 7 or more hours per night experience the most significant improvements in sleep quality, as measured by subjective reports and objective sleep metrics. However, adjusting to the mask, air pressure, and noise can pose initial challenges. Starting with lower pressure settings and gradually increasing them, as prescribed by a sleep specialist, can enhance comfort. Additionally, choosing a mask style that suits facial contours and sleeping positions (nasal, full-face, or nasal pillow) is essential for long-term compliance.

Comparing CPAP to alternative treatments highlights its unique advantages. Oral appliances, for instance, may alleviate mild to moderate sleep apnea but are less effective for severe cases. Surgical interventions, such as uvulopalatopharyngoplasty (UPPP), carry risks and variable success rates. CPAP, in contrast, offers immediate and consistent relief without invasive procedures. Moreover, CPAP's benefits extend beyond sleep quality, improving cardiovascular health, cognitive function, and mood. A 2019 meta-analysis in the *Journal of Sleep Research* found that CPAP users reported a 50% reduction in excessive daytime sleepiness and a 30% improvement in quality-of-life scores compared to untreated individuals.

For optimal results, CPAP therapy should be tailored to individual needs. Pressure settings are determined through titration studies, ensuring the lowest effective pressure to maintain airway patency. Modern CPAP machines often include auto-adjusting features, which dynamically respond to changing airway resistance during sleep. Regular follow-ups with a sleep physician are crucial to monitor progress, adjust settings, and address any side effects, such as nasal congestion or mask leaks. Practical tips, such as using a humidifier to alleviate dryness or applying mask liners to reduce skin irritation, can further enhance the CPAP experience. When used correctly, CPAP is a transformative tool, turning restless nights into restorative sleep.

CPAP benefits for sleep apnea patients

Sleep apnea disrupts sleep by causing repeated breathing pauses throughout the night, leading to fragmented rest and daytime fatigue. Continuous Positive Airway Pressure (CPAP) therapy directly addresses this issue by delivering a steady stream of pressurized air through a mask, keeping the airway open. This mechanical intervention prevents the collapses that trigger apneas, allowing for uninterrupted sleep cycles. Studies show that CPAP use significantly reduces the Apnea-Hypopnea Index (AHI), a measure of sleep apnea severity, often lowering it from severe (AHI >30) to normal levels (AHI <5) within weeks of consistent use.

Beyond improving sleep continuity, CPAP therapy offers systemic health benefits by addressing the root cause of sleep apnea. Chronic sleep disruption is linked to hypertension, cardiovascular disease, and cognitive impairment. By restoring normal breathing patterns, CPAP reduces blood pressure in hypertensive patients, lowers the risk of stroke and heart failure, and improves insulin sensitivity, benefiting those with type 2 diabetes. For example, a 2015 study in the *Journal of the American Medical Association* found that CPAP use was associated with a 27% reduction in cardiovascular events among sleep apnea patients over a 10-year period.

Adherence to CPAP therapy is critical for maximizing its benefits, yet many patients struggle with initial discomfort or mask fit issues. Practical tips include starting with short daytime sessions to acclimate to the mask, using a humidifier to alleviate nasal dryness, and experimenting with different mask styles (nasal, full-face, or nasal pillow) to find the best fit. Clinicians often recommend auto-CPAP machines, which adjust pressure levels based on real-time breathing patterns, enhancing comfort and effectiveness. For older adults or those with dexterity issues, masks with magnetic clips or quick-release straps simplify usage.

While CPAP is highly effective, it is not a one-size-fits-all solution. Side effects like bloating, nasal congestion, or skin irritation may occur but are often manageable with adjustments. For patients who cannot tolerate CPAP, alternatives such as oral appliances or positional therapy (sleeping on the side) may be considered. However, CPAP remains the gold standard for moderate to severe sleep apnea, particularly in patients over 50 or those with comorbidities like obesity or cardiovascular disease. Regular follow-ups with a sleep specialist ensure optimal pressure settings and address emerging concerns, making CPAP a dynamic and personalized treatment.

In summary, CPAP therapy transforms sleep quality for apnea patients by eliminating airway obstructions and restoring normal sleep architecture. Its benefits extend beyond the bedroom, mitigating risks of chronic diseases and enhancing overall quality of life. While initial adjustments may be required, the long-term payoff—restorative sleep and improved health—makes CPAP an indispensable tool for managing sleep apnea effectively.

CPAP impact on snoring reduction

Snoring, often dismissed as a mere nocturnal nuisance, can be a symptom of a more serious condition like obstructive sleep apnea (OSA). Continuous Positive Airway Pressure (CPAP) therapy is a frontline treatment for OSA, and its impact on snoring reduction is both immediate and profound. By delivering a steady stream of pressurized air through a mask, CPAP prevents the collapse of the upper airway, the primary cause of snoring in OSA patients. This mechanical intervention not only eliminates the vibrations that produce snoring sounds but also ensures uninterrupted breathing, leading to deeper, more restorative sleep.

Consider the mechanics: during sleep, the muscles of the throat relax, narrowing the airway. In individuals with OSA, this narrowing becomes severe enough to cause partial or complete blockage, resulting in snoring and apnea events. CPAP machines counteract this by maintaining a consistent air pressure, typically ranging from 6 to 14 cm H2O, tailored to the patient’s needs. This pressure acts as a pneumatic splint, keeping the airway open. Studies show that CPAP therapy reduces snoring frequency and intensity in over 90% of users, often from the first night of use. For bed partners, this translates to a quieter, more peaceful sleep environment.

However, success with CPAP isn’t automatic. Proper mask fit and machine calibration are critical. A mask that leaks or a pressure setting that’s too low can diminish effectiveness. Patients should work closely with a sleep specialist to fine-tune their settings and address discomfort, such as nasal dryness or mask irritation. Using a humidifier attachment or switching to a full-face mask can alleviate these issues. Compliance is key: consistent nightly use maximizes snoring reduction and overall sleep quality.

Comparatively, CPAP outperforms many alternative snoring remedies. Over-the-counter devices like nasal strips or mouth guards may offer mild relief but fail to address the root cause of OSA-related snoring. Surgical options, such as uvulopalatopharyngoplasty (UPPP), carry risks and variable success rates. CPAP, while requiring adaptation, provides a non-invasive, highly effective solution. Its dual benefit—snoring reduction and OSA management—makes it a preferred choice for both patients and clinicians.

In practice, incorporating CPAP into a nightly routine requires patience and commitment. Start by using the device for short periods during the day to acclimate to the sensation. Gradually increase usage time until full-night compliance is achieved. For those struggling with adherence, joining support groups or using CPAP-tracking apps can provide motivation. While the initial adjustment period may be challenging, the long-term benefits—reduced snoring, improved sleep, and enhanced daytime alertness—far outweigh the temporary inconvenience. CPAP isn’t just a snoring solution; it’s a gateway to better overall health.

CPAP and REM sleep enhancement

CPAP therapy is widely recognized for its effectiveness in treating sleep apnea, a condition that disrupts sleep by causing repeated breathing pauses. One of its lesser-known benefits is its ability to enhance REM (Rapid Eye Movement) sleep, a critical stage for memory consolidation, emotional processing, and overall cognitive function. During REM sleep, the brain is highly active, and the body experiences temporary muscle paralysis to prevent physical responses to dreams. Sleep apnea, however, fragments this stage, leading to poor sleep quality and daytime fatigue. By delivering a steady stream of pressurized air, CPAP machines keep airways open, reducing apneic events and allowing for longer, uninterrupted periods of REM sleep.

To maximize REM sleep enhancement with CPAP, adherence to therapy is crucial. Studies show that consistent CPAP use for at least 4 hours per night can significantly improve REM sleep duration in adults over 18, particularly those with moderate to severe sleep apnea. For optimal results, ensure the CPAP mask fits properly and the pressure settings are calibrated by a sleep specialist. Modern CPAP devices often include features like ramp settings, which gradually increase air pressure to ease the transition to sleep, and heated humidifiers to prevent nasal dryness, both of which can improve comfort and compliance.

A comparative analysis reveals that CPAP outperforms other sleep apnea treatments, such as oral appliances or positional therapy, in restoring REM sleep. While oral appliances may alleviate mild cases, they often fall short in severe sleep apnea, where CPAP remains the gold standard. Positional therapy, which involves avoiding sleeping on the back, can reduce apneic events but does not address the underlying airway obstruction as effectively as CPAP. For individuals struggling with REM sleep deprivation, CPAP offers a direct and reliable solution by stabilizing breathing patterns throughout the night.

Practical tips for enhancing REM sleep with CPAP include creating a sleep-conducive environment. Keep the bedroom cool (60–67°F or 15–19°C), dark, and quiet. Establish a consistent sleep schedule, aiming for 7–9 hours of sleep per night, as REM sleep increases in duration during the later stages of the sleep cycle. Avoid caffeine and alcohol close to bedtime, as they can interfere with both sleep apnea and REM sleep. Finally, track your progress using CPAP data logs or sleep apps to monitor improvements in sleep quality and REM duration, making adjustments as needed in consultation with a healthcare provider.

In conclusion, CPAP therapy not only alleviates sleep apnea symptoms but also plays a pivotal role in enhancing REM sleep, a vital component of restorative rest. By addressing airway obstructions, CPAP enables longer, uninterrupted REM cycles, leading to improved cognitive function and overall well-being. With proper use and adherence, individuals can experience significant sleep quality improvements, making CPAP an indispensable tool for those seeking better sleep health.

CPAP side effects on sleep patterns

While CPAP therapy is a gold standard treatment for sleep apnea, its impact on sleep quality isn't always straightforward. One common side effect is mask discomfort, which can lead to frequent awakenings and reduced total sleep time. The pressure from the mask, coupled with the sensation of forced air, may cause irritation or claustrophobia, particularly in the first few weeks of use. Patients often report difficulty falling back asleep after these disruptions, highlighting the need for proper mask fitting and acclimatization strategies.

Another significant side effect is air leakage, which not only diminishes the effectiveness of CPAP therapy but also disrupts sleep patterns. Leaks can cause dryness in the nasal passages, throat irritation, or even loud noises that wake both the user and their bed partner. Adjusting the mask strap tension, using a humidifier, or switching to a different mask type (e.g., nasal pillows vs. full-face masks) can mitigate these issues. However, finding the right solution often requires trial and error, during which sleep quality may fluctuate.

Central sleep apnea, a less common form of sleep apnea, can paradoxically worsen with CPAP use in some individuals. Unlike obstructive sleep apnea, where CPAP is highly effective, central sleep apnea involves the brain failing to signal proper breathing. CPAP’s constant air pressure can sometimes interfere with the body’s natural breathing rhythm, leading to fragmented sleep. In such cases, alternative treatments like bilevel positive airway pressure (BiPAP) or adaptive servo-ventilation (ASV) may be more appropriate, though these require careful medical evaluation.

Finally, psychological factors play a role in CPAP’s impact on sleep patterns. Anxiety about using the machine or frustration with its bulkiness can create a mental barrier to restful sleep. Patients aged 65 and older, in particular, may struggle with the device’s complexity or feel self-conscious about its appearance. Cognitive-behavioral therapy (CBT) or support groups can help address these concerns, while practical tips like incorporating the CPAP into a bedtime routine can improve adherence and sleep continuity.

In summary, while CPAP therapy is transformative for many with sleep apnea, its side effects on sleep patterns—ranging from physical discomfort to psychological barriers—require proactive management. Customizing the device, addressing specific issues like air leaks or mask fit, and seeking emotional support can help maximize its benefits and ensure a more restorative night’s sleep.
